Junior Linguist - Full-time Temporary Contract

Remote role Full-time Open position
Mango Languages is seeking a Linguist with exceptional content instincts to lead an ambitious development initiative. The Linguist will be responsible for planning and executing a clear strategy for long-form content across multiple products, maintaining high-quality standards—even in languages the candidate may not speak—and ensuring that projects remain on schedule. Close collaboration with linguists, stakeholders, and cross-functional teams is essential, along with clear, consistent communication and thorough documentation. Ideal candidates will bring a background in linguistics, a passion for global cultures, and a deep understanding of what makes content effective and engaging. Experience with language-learning tools and creating diverse content types—such as articles, songs, and stories—is key, as is a strong comfort level using AI tools responsibly. The role will require cultural sensitivity, organizational efficiency, and a collaborative spirit, with a bonus for those who have proficiency in less commonly taught or non-Indo European languages. Candidates must be adaptable, communicative, and motivated by a love of language learning and cross-cultural exchange. The contract for this position is tied to a specific project and will therefore last through project completion (likely 6-9 months). Contract extensions and/or conversion to employee status are a possibility if the project is extended and collaboration is successful.

Responsibilities

  • Lead content development efforts by working with subject matter experts to generate educational content for world language and ESL learners
  • Craft engaging, culturally-rich, fiction and non-fiction texts for language learners on a wide range of topics
  • Develop and deliver on a content strategy for multiple products while keeping to a release calendar
  • Ensure that content adheres to Mango Languages’ high quality standards, including content in languages you are not familiar with
  • Plan and organize work so that teams keep project timelines
  • Collaborate closely with other linguists and stakeholders to drive the project toward the desired goal
  • Communicate effectively so that all teams understand expectations
  • Create and maintain organized documentation
  • Attend and participate in regular team meetings
  • Assist in recruiting, interviewing, and onboarding content development team members

Job Requirements

  • B.A. or M.A. in Linguistics or a related field
  • Exceptional instincts for what constitutes engaging content
  • Affinity for using AI tools, balanced with an understanding of their limitations
  • Must have a global mindset and be eager to learn about other cultures
  • Must have general linguistic knowledge of languages from different families
  • Experience creating articles, stories, passages, songs, or other content
  • Experience using language-learning products
  • Native or near-native English speaker
  • Reliable internet connection

Key Characteristics

  • Enthusiasm for sharing the love of learning languages
  • Strong attention to cultural nuance and sensitivity
  • Excellent time management and organizational skills
  • Strong skills in giving and receiving feedback
  • Able to easily learn and adapt to new technology
  • Strong communication skills and responsiveness
  • Positive energy

Bonus

  • Strong proficiency in one or more non-Indo European languages
